This webinar and supporting resources sharesinformation on several funding options that students and families can explore, such as Vocational Rehabilitation, Medicaid, scholarships, federal student financial aid, Veteran’s benefits, and ABLE accounts. Details of each funding source are shared, as well as an overview of the conditions under which available funding possibilities may be an option....Read more
